Transaction 268ba4f360ad2ba3ae19a1d546ae3b621a9d8d6e9b889e95d6fa16c4c1a90613
1 Input
1 Output
-
268ba4f360ad2ba3ae19a1d546ae3b621a9d8d6e9b889e95d6fa16c4c1a90613:0
- value
- 43506660
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f76ca44cf10d7c6cd4673f41f33a673d5a944c2
- address
- bc1q3amv53x0zrtudn2xw06p7vaxw026j3xzreyy8j